A fresh coat of paint can completely change the appearance of your home. It can make an older property look cared for, improve street appeal and provide valuable protection against Sydney’s changing weather. However, exterior painting is not simply a matter of choosing a colour and picking up a brush. Small mistakes during preparation or application can affect the final result and may mean you need to repaint sooner than expected.
If you are considering exterior painting for your home, here are five common mistakes to avoid.
1. Skipping Proper Surface Preparation
One of the biggest mistakes homeowners make is rushing into painting without preparing the surface properly. Dirt, dust, peeling paint, mould and small cracks can prevent new paint from bonding correctly.
Before painting, exterior surfaces should be thoroughly cleaned and inspected. Peeling or damaged areas need to be scraped and repaired, while cracks and gaps should be filled appropriately. Good preparation takes time, but it creates the foundation for a smoother and longer-lasting finish.
2. Choosing the Wrong Paint
Not every type of paint is suitable for exterior surfaces. Using an interior product outside, or choosing a paint that is not appropriate for the particular surface, can result in fading, cracking, peeling or poor coverage.
Exterior walls, timber, metal and other surfaces may require different preparation and paint products. It is worth getting professional advice before making your selection. A suitable exterior coating can help your home stand up better to weather exposure.
3. Ignoring the Weather
Sydney weather can change quickly, and painting on the wrong day can cause unnecessary problems. Extremely hot conditions, rain or high humidity can interfere with how paint dries and cures.
Painting professionals understand that timing matters. The surface needs suitable conditions so the paint can dry properly and develop an even finish. Planning the work around the weather can make a noticeable difference to the final result.
4. Applying Paint Too Quickly
It can be tempting to finish an exterior painting project as quickly as possible, particularly when the whole house is involved. However, applying thick coats or failing to allow sufficient drying time between coats can lead to uneven coverage and other problems.
Professional painters focus on applying the right amount of paint and allowing each coat to dry as recommended. Taking a little extra time during the process can help achieve a cleaner and more durable finish.
